make it a home
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"make it a home"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to the process of transforming a space into a comfortable and welcoming living environment. Example: "After moving in, we decided to make it a home by adding personal touches and decorations."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When writing about creating a welcoming atmosphere, use "make it a home" to convey warmth and personalization. For example, "They added personal touches to make it a home."
Common error
Avoid overusing "make it a home" when a more specific term like "renovate", "decorate", or "furnish" would be more accurate to describe the actions taken.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"make it a home" functions as a verb phrase, where 'make' is the main verb, 'it' is the pronoun referring to a place (house, apartment), and 'a home' is the direct object indicating the transformation. Ludwig confirms its correct usage.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
turn it into a home
Emphasizes the act of changing something into a home.
create a home
Focuses on the act of building or establishing a home environment.
make it feel like home
Highlights the emotional aspect of creating a welcoming atmosphere.
establish a home
Implies a more permanent and settled approach to creating a home.
build a home
Focuses on the physical construction or establishment of a home.
set up house
Suggests arranging and organizing a place to live comfortably.
domesticate the space
A more formal way of saying to make a place feel like home.
make it habitable
Focuses on making a place livable, potentially from a state of uninhabitability.
personalize the space
Emphasizes adding personal touches to make a place feel like one's own.
make it comfortable
Highlights the importance of comfort and relaxation in creating a home.
FAQs
How can I use "make it a home" in a sentence?
You can use "make it a home" to describe transforming a house into a comfortable and personalized living space. For example, "After moving in, they worked hard to "make it a home"."
What can I say instead of "make it a home"?
Alternatives include "turn it into a home", "create a home", or "make it feel like home" depending on the specific context.
Is it correct to say "make a home" instead of "make it a home"?
While "make a home" is grammatically correct, ""make it a home"" typically refers to transforming a specific space into a home, whereas "make a home" is more general.
What's the difference between "make it a home" and "decorate it"?
"Make it a home" encompasses the overall process of creating a comfortable living environment, whereas "decorate it" refers specifically to adding aesthetic elements.
